Searched refs:BlockMedia (Results 1 – 12 of 12) sorted by relevance
/device/linaro/bootloader/edk2/MdeModulePkg/Bus/Ata/AtaBusDxe/ |
D | AtaPassThruExecute.c | 304 EFI_BLOCK_IO_MEDIA *BlockMedia; in IdentifyAtaDevice() local 350 BlockMedia = &AtaDevice->BlockMedia; in IdentifyAtaDevice() 351 BlockMedia->LastBlock = Capacity - 1; in IdentifyAtaDevice() 352 BlockMedia->IoAlign = AtaDevice->AtaBusDriverData->AtaPassThru->Mode->IoAlign; in IdentifyAtaDevice() 362 BlockMedia->LogicalBlocksPerPhysicalBlock = (UINT32) (1 << (PhyLogicSectorSupport & 0x000f)); in IdentifyAtaDevice() 367 …BlockMedia->LowestAlignedLba = (EFI_LBA) ((BlockMedia->LogicalBlocksPerPhysicalBlock - ((UINT32)Id… in IdentifyAtaDevice() 368 BlockMedia->LogicalBlocksPerPhysicalBlock); in IdentifyAtaDevice() 375 …BlockMedia->BlockSize = (UINT32) (((IdentifyData->logic_sector_size_hi << 16) | IdentifyData->logi… in IdentifyAtaDevice() 553 …IMER_PERIOD_SECONDS (DivU64x32 (MultU64x32 (TransferLength, AtaDevice->BlockMedia.BlockSize), 2100… in TransferAtaDevice() 558 …IMER_PERIOD_SECONDS (DivU64x32 (MultU64x32 (TransferLength, AtaDevice->BlockMedia.BlockSize), 3300… in TransferAtaDevice() [all …]
|
D | AtaBus.h | 106 EFI_BLOCK_IO_MEDIA BlockMedia; member
|
D | AtaBus.c | 273 AtaDevice->BlockIo.Media = &AtaDevice->BlockMedia; in RegisterAtaDevice() 274 AtaDevice->BlockIo2.Media = &AtaDevice->BlockMedia; in RegisterAtaDevice()
|
/device/linaro/bootloader/edk2/MdeModulePkg/Bus/Sd/SdDxe/ |
D | SdDxe.c | 245 Device->BlockIo.Media = &Device->BlockMedia; in DiscoverUserArea() 246 Device->BlockIo2.Media = &Device->BlockMedia; in DiscoverUserArea() 247 Device->BlockMedia.IoAlign = Device->Private->PassThru->IoAlign; in DiscoverUserArea() 248 Device->BlockMedia.BlockSize = 0x200; in DiscoverUserArea() 249 Device->BlockMedia.LastBlock = 0x00; in DiscoverUserArea() 250 Device->BlockMedia.RemovableMedia = TRUE; in DiscoverUserArea() 251 Device->BlockMedia.MediaPresent = TRUE; in DiscoverUserArea() 252 Device->BlockMedia.LogicalPartition = FALSE; in DiscoverUserArea() 253 Device->BlockMedia.LastBlock = DivU64x32 (Capacity, Device->BlockMedia.BlockSize) - 1; in DiscoverUserArea()
|
D | SdBlockIo.c | 376 …RwSingleBlkReq->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(Lba, Device->BlockMedia.BlockSiz… in SdRwSingleBlock() 538 …RwMultiBlkReq->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(Lba, Device->BlockMedia.BlockSize… in SdRwMultiBlocks() 640 Media = &Device->BlockMedia; in SdReadWrite() 1067 …EraseBlockStart->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(StartLba, Device->BlockMedia.Bl… in SdEraseBlockStart() 1171 …EraseBlockEnd->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(EndLba, Device->BlockMedia.BlockS… in SdEraseBlockEnd() 1366 Media = &Device->BlockMedia; in SdEraseBlocks()
|
D | SdDxe.h | 101 EFI_BLOCK_IO_MEDIA BlockMedia; member
|
/device/linaro/bootloader/edk2/IntelFrameworkModulePkg/Csm/BiosThunk/BlockIoDxe/ |
D | BiosInt13.c | 54 EFI_BLOCK_IO_MEDIA *BlockMedia; in BiosInitBlockIo() local 58 BlockIo->Media = &Dev->BlockMedia; in BiosInitBlockIo() 59 BlockMedia = BlockIo->Media; in BiosInitBlockIo() 64 BlockMedia->LastBlock = (EFI_LBA) Bios->Parameters.PhysicalSectors - 1; in BiosInitBlockIo() 65 BlockMedia->BlockSize = (UINT32) Bios->Parameters.BytesPerSector; in BiosInitBlockIo() 68 BlockMedia->RemovableMedia = TRUE; in BiosInitBlockIo() 75 BlockMedia->BlockSize = 512; in BiosInitBlockIo() 76 BlockMedia->LastBlock = (Bios->MaxHead + 1) * Bios->MaxSector * (Bios->MaxCylinder + 1) - 1; in BiosInitBlockIo() 79 …DEBUG ((DEBUG_INIT, "BlockSize = %d LastBlock = %d\n", BlockMedia->BlockSize, BlockMedia->LastBlo… in BiosInitBlockIo() 81 BlockMedia->LogicalPartition = FALSE; in BiosInitBlockIo() [all …]
|
D | Edd.h | 198 EFI_BLOCK_IO_MEDIA BlockMedia; member
|
D | BiosBlkIo.c | 413 BiosBlockIoPrivate->BlockMedia.RemovableMedia = FALSE; in BiosBlockIoDriverBindingStart()
|
/device/linaro/bootloader/edk2/MdeModulePkg/Bus/Sd/EmmcDxe/ |
D | EmmcDxe.c | 330 Partition->BlockIo.Media = &Partition->BlockMedia; in DiscoverAllPartitions() 331 Partition->BlockIo2.Media = &Partition->BlockMedia; in DiscoverAllPartitions() 333 Partition->BlockMedia.IoAlign = Device->Private->PassThru->IoAlign; in DiscoverAllPartitions() 334 Partition->BlockMedia.BlockSize = 0x200; in DiscoverAllPartitions() 335 Partition->BlockMedia.LastBlock = 0x00; in DiscoverAllPartitions() 336 Partition->BlockMedia.RemovableMedia = FALSE; in DiscoverAllPartitions() 337 Partition->BlockMedia.MediaPresent = TRUE; in DiscoverAllPartitions() 338 Partition->BlockMedia.LogicalPartition = FALSE; in DiscoverAllPartitions() 375 Partition->BlockMedia.LastBlock = DivU64x32 (Capacity, Partition->BlockMedia.BlockSize) - 1; in DiscoverAllPartitions()
|
D | EmmcDxe.h | 102 EFI_BLOCK_IO_MEDIA BlockMedia; member
|
D | EmmcBlockIo.c | 724 …RwMultiBlkReq->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(Lba, Partition->BlockMedia.BlockS… in EmmcRwMultiBlocks() 824 Media = &Partition->BlockMedia; in EmmcReadWrite() 1313 Media = &Partition->BlockMedia; in EmmcSecurityProtocolInOut() 1646 …tart->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(StartLba, Partition->BlockMedia.BlockSize); in EmmcEraseBlockStart() 1753 …EraseBlockEnd->SdMmcCmdBlk.CommandArgument = (UINT32)MultU64x32 (EndLba, Partition->BlockMedia.Blo… in EmmcEraseBlockEnd() 1954 Media = &Partition->BlockMedia; in EmmcEraseBlocks()
|